Vinkius supports streamable HTTP and SSE.
import asyncio
from autogen_agentchat.agents import AssistantAgent
from autogen_ext.tools.mcp import McpWorkbench
async def main():
# Your Vinkius token. get it at cloud.vinkius.com
async with McpWorkbench(
server_params={"url": "https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p"},
transport="streamable_http",
) as workbench:
tools = await workbench.list_tools()
agent = AssistantAgent(
name="nagerdate_agent",
tools=tools,
system_message=(
"You help users with Nager.Date. "
"6 tools available."
),
)
print(f"Agent ready with {len(tools)} tools")
asyncio.run(main())

Nager.Date MCP Tools for AutoGen (6)
These 6 tools become available when you connect Nager.Date to AutoGen via MCP:
get_country_details
Get additional details for a specific country
get_next_holidays
Get the next public holidays for a specific country
get_next_holidays_worldwide
Get the next public holidays occurring worldwide
get_public_holidays
Get all public holidays for a country and year
is_holiday_today
Check if today is a public holiday in a country
list_available_countries
Date. List all countries supported by Nager.Date
